    Sappi is a global company focused on providing dissolving wood pulp, paper-pulp and paper based solutions to its direct and indirect customer base across more than 100 countries. Our dissolving wood pulp is used worldwide by converters to create viscose fibre for clothing and textiles, acetate tow, pharmaceutical products as well as a wide range of consumer ...

    Process Controller Chemical

    We’re on the lookout for an experienced Process Controller Chemical to safely and efficiently operate the equipment under his/her control, and co-ordinate plant activities on a shift basis. Ensure optimum production output and quality within budget. 

     As a Process Controller Chemical, you will be responsible for: 

    • Take and hand over the shift, utilize the electronic reporting systems
    • Evaluates data input of the previous shift and react accordingly
    • Check quality sheets and exception reports
    • Understand the forecast of the shift
    • Evaluate external plant influences and communicate to Shift Superintendent
    • Ensure continuity of communication
    • Communicate plant status with Shift Superintendent and Outside Operator
    • Ensure response to, execution of, and communication to all levels where necessary (briefs, emails, memos, etc.).
    • Optimise plant status within current constraints (raw materials, and services)
    • Do rate changes as requested
    • Ensure corrective action on all non-conformances
    • Execute production activities i.e. shut, start-ups and stops, exception reports, log sheets, graphs, trends, etc.
    • Do grade changes as requested
    • Doing pump changeover as per schedule
    • Complete PJO’s
    • Compile and update best practices as required
    • Ensure good housekeeping practices
    • Optimize raw material consumption
    • Ensure that all equipment defects are attended to immediately
    • Accountable to ensure adherence to all safety BP’s, procedures, and BBS.
    • Ensure adherence to specific Legal regulatory requirements.
    • Raise and close out SHEQ deviations
    • Maintain, update, and prioritize the shut list

    What are we looking for?

    • Relevant Post Matric Certificate (NQF Level 5) or Diploma
    • Minimum of 2 years relevant experience
    • A relevant plant license will be advantageous
